What Makes a Chandelier “Minimalist”?
Minimalist chandeliers emphasize form over flourish, often using:
- Clean lines and geometric shapes
- Open structures with negative space
- Monochromatic or dual-tone finishes
- Slim profiles or flat LED integrations
- Lack of ornamentation (no crystals or scrollwork)

Popular Minimalist Chandelier Shapes
| Shape / Layout | Description | Best Placement |
|---|---|---|
| Linear bar | A sleek line of light or pendants | Kitchen island, dining table |
| Ring / Halo | Circular LED or brass structures | Living room, foyer |
| Branch / Mobile | Abstract arms or asymmetrical balance | Staircase, gallery ceiling |
| Disc or Panel | Flat, sculptural fixtures with glow | Bedroom, office |

Finish Trends in Minimalist Chandeliers
Minimalist lighting doesn’t mean boring. In fact, contrast and restraint make materials pop:
| Finish | Vibe | Pair With |
|---|---|---|
| Matte Black | Industrial, architectural | Concrete, light wood, neutrals |
| Brushed Brass | Warm minimalism, retro modern | White walls, oak, mid-century pieces |
| Satin Nickel | Sleek and cool-toned | Monochrome interiors, grey palette |
| White on White | Ultra-minimal & airy | Japandi, Scandinavian styles |

Materials Matter: Quality in Simplicity
| Material | Benefits |
|---|---|
| Aluminum | Lightweight, durable, perfect for LED frames |
| Glass (Frosted) | Softens light, adds dimension |
| Acrylic | Great for halo or flat-ring designs |
| Metal & Wood | Natural texture meets structure |
Minimalist doesn’t mean cheap—premium materials are more exposed, so quality matters.
Where to Use Minimalist Chandeliers

🛏️ Bedroom:
Go for soft ring lighting or horizontal lines over the bed for ambient glow.
🍽 Dining Area:
Choose a linear LED or bar chandelier to hang above a table, suspended 30–36 in above.
🛋 Living Room:
Use mobile, asymmetrical, or oversized single-arm chandeliers for sculptural impact.
🪟 Entryway:
Try a vertical ring or minimal pendant stack to define the space without bulk.
Features to Look For
Modern minimalist chandeliers often include:
- ✅ Integrated LED modules (no bulb changes)
- ✅ Adjustable height or cable length
- ✅ Dimmable drivers (0–10V, Triac)
- ✅ Smart lighting compatibility (Tuya, Zigbee)
- ✅ Minimalist ceiling canopy with concealed hardware

Q: What light temperature works best for modern minimalist design?
A: 3000K–3500K for soft white; 4000K+ for clean daylight tones.
